the elapsed time the angular acceleration of the blades the linear velocity of the blade tips A rowing machine consits of a flywheel with a diameter of 80-cm An athlete applies a tangential force of 10-N to the rim and the flywheel takes 1.5 s to complete one revolution. If the flywheel starts from rest; Determine; the applied torque the angular acceleration of the flywheel the wheel moment of inertia the wheel's kinetic energy when it reaches its first revolution the average power applied to the wheel

Explanation / Answer

a) applied Torque = F*r = 10*0.4 = 4Nm, Torque = I*alpha, and s = alpha*t^2, so alpha = s/t^2= 2pi/1.5^2 = 2.7925,

b)so alpha = 2.7925,

c)I = torque/alpha = 4/2.7925 = 1.4324kgm^2,

d) energy = 1/2 Iw^2 = 1/2*4*w^2, also w^2 = 2*alpha*s = 2*2.7925*2pi = 35, so energy = 70.18J,

e)Power = work/time = 70.18J/1.5 = 46.78watt
